Jenny J.......Almost, but I'm not over 100 years old. LOL Take a look at the Portraits of George Washington. Look close and you will see a wig, makeup on his face, nail polish on his hands, lace on his clothing, and 2-3" high heel shoes on his feet. This was very common back then. The makeup was used to cover up signs of past illness that would scar ones face and make ones nails black in color. The wig because most men loss their hair due to past illness, and the high heels was influence by British Royalty fashion. They also wore a lot of perfume. Hygiene was not well known back then.

Hygiene became the norm, so men stopped using perfume, diseases were conquored, so men stopped using makeup, wearing wigs, and fashions changed and men stoppe wearing high heels and lace.

It those traits had continued today, would a lot of what we do be considered Crossdressing?
